Why Are Burritos Called Burritos

Across the globe, burritos are noted as a staple in Mexican cuisine. The meat, cheese, bean, and veggie stuffed tortillas are extremely popular, but most people are unaware of their origins. The word burrito translates to “little donkey”, stemming from “burro” which means donkey, and “-ito” which means little. Burritos do not contain any donkey products and they do not look like donkeys, so where did the name come from? The truth is that we don’t know for a fact who invented the burrito or why. We know that burritos were invented sometime in the 20th century and that there are many theories about their creation. Here are a few examples of theories:

Theories

  • Juan Méndez, a street vendor in Chihuahua, Mexico, invented the burrito. During the Mexican Revolution in the 1910s, Méndez decided to wrap his food in flour tortillas to keep it warm and transport it on his small donkey. He then realized that wrapping the food in a tortilla was tasty and a good way to serve it.
  • People from a northwestern state of Mexico, called Sonora, invented the burrito because of its mobility. Burritos in Mexico at the time were not as stuffed and full as they are today in the United States, so they were extremely easy to travel with. This influenced the burrito’s name because it was the donkey’s sidekick in travel.
  • The burrito was invented in Ciudad Juárez in the 1940s by a street vendor. He portioned the food and wrapped it in a tortilla, making it appropriate for school children, whom he derogatively referred to as “burritos” because he believed they were unintelligent.

While their origins are unclear, burritos have stood the test of time. While they were likely simple at the time of their creation, burritos have evolved to include an enormous variety of ingredients, fillings, and flavors. The more classic-styled burritos typically contain some of the following ingredients:

Ingredients

  • Beans
  • Rice
  • Meat
  • Guacamole
  • Salsa
  • Pico de gallo
  • Cheese
  • Sour Cream
  • Corn
  • Lettuce
  • Peppers
  • … and more!
